I got these last lines on compiling:

./configure --enable-add-ons=linuxthreads prefix=/usr/glibc

make :
------------
...
/opt/glibc-2.3.4/build/linuxthreads/libpthread_pic.a(pthread.os): In function 
`pthread_initialize':
/opt/glibc-2.3.4/linuxthreads/pthread.c:549: undefined reference to `_res'
/opt/glibc-2.3.4/build/linuxthreads/libpthread_pic.a(pthread.os): In function 
`__pthread_reset_main_thread':
/opt/glibc-2.3.4/linuxthreads/pthread.c:1145: undefined reference to `_errno'
/opt/glibc-2.3.4/linuxthreads/pthread.c:1146: undefined reference to 
`_h_errno'
/opt/glibc-2.3.4/linuxthreads/pthread.c:1147: undefined reference to `_res'
/opt/glibc-2.3.4/build/linuxthreads/libpthread_pic.a(pthread.os):
(.data.rel+0x1b8): undefined reference to `_errno'
/opt/glibc-2.3.4/build/linuxthreads/libpthread_pic.a(pthread.os):
(.data.rel+0x1c0): undefined reference to `_h_errno'
/opt/glibc-2.3.4/build/linuxthreads/libpthread_pic.a(pthread.os):
(.data.rel+0x1c8): undefined reference to `_res'
collect2: ld returned 1 exit status
make[2]: *** [/opt/glibc-2.3.4/build/linuxthreads/libpthread.so] Fehler 1
make[2]: Leaving directory `/opt/glibc-2.3.4/linuxthreads'
make[1]: *** [linuxthreads/others] Fehler 2
make[1]: Leaving directory `/opt/glibc-2.3.4'
make: *** [all] Fehler 2
server:/opt/glibc-2.3.4/build #
------------

gcc-Version 3.3.2
GNU ld version 2.16.1
GNU Make 3.80
used kernel headers: linux-i368-2.4.31
AMD K7  800MHz

May be it's a simple thing, but I don't get it.
